summaryrefslogtreecommitdiff
path: root/metadata
diff options
context:
space:
mode:
authorDennis Kasprzyk <onestone@compiz-fusion.org>2008-12-17 12:23:26 +0100
committerDennis Kasprzyk <onestone@compiz-fusion.org>2008-12-17 12:23:26 +0100
commit696e9970b993b9f2904f3d8b6b0e7867be87c140 (patch)
tree1fd1d3947e0b1fa6e6fa959e4342ca66091a3591 /metadata
parentd07535262054cf3e0043114b60a428f795bd103b (diff)
downloadzcomp-696e9970b993b9f2904f3d8b6b0e7867be87c140.tar.gz
zcomp-696e9970b993b9f2904f3d8b6b0e7867be87c140.tar.bz2
Fixed plugin dependencies in metadata.
Diffstat (limited to 'metadata')
-rw-r--r--metadata/blur.xml.in3
-rw-r--r--metadata/decor.xml.in4
-rw-r--r--metadata/move.xml.in6
-rw-r--r--metadata/opengl.xml.in5
-rw-r--r--metadata/place.xml.in4
-rw-r--r--metadata/resize.xml.in6
-rw-r--r--metadata/switcher.xml.in5
-rw-r--r--metadata/water.xml.in3
8 files changed, 34 insertions, 2 deletions
diff --git a/metadata/blur.xml.in b/metadata/blur.xml.in
index ed69489..89a235a 100644
--- a/metadata/blur.xml.in
+++ b/metadata/blur.xml.in
@@ -10,6 +10,9 @@
<relation type="after">
<plugin>decoration</plugin>
</relation>
+ <requirement>
+ <plugin>opengl</plugin>
+ </requirement>
</deps>
<options>
<option name="pulse" type="bell">
diff --git a/metadata/decor.xml.in b/metadata/decor.xml.in
index 450bac0..8c4a36a 100644
--- a/metadata/decor.xml.in
+++ b/metadata/decor.xml.in
@@ -10,6 +10,10 @@
<plugin>scale</plugin>
<plugin>wobbly</plugin>
</relation>
+ <relation type="after">
+ <plugin>composite</plugin>
+ <plugin>opengl</plugin>
+ </relation>
</deps>
<options>
<option name="shadow_radius" type="float">
diff --git a/metadata/move.xml.in b/metadata/move.xml.in
index be80c6c..e3a6eb7 100644
--- a/metadata/move.xml.in
+++ b/metadata/move.xml.in
@@ -2,6 +2,12 @@
<plugin name="move">
<_short>Move Window</_short>
<_long>Move window</_long>
+ <deps>
+ <relation type="after">
+ <plugin>composite</plugin>
+ <plugin>opengl</plugin>
+ </relation>
+ </deps>
<options>
<option name="initiate_button" type="button">
<_short>Initiate Window Move</_short>
diff --git a/metadata/opengl.xml.in b/metadata/opengl.xml.in
index 484e10f..6a95685 100644
--- a/metadata/opengl.xml.in
+++ b/metadata/opengl.xml.in
@@ -2,6 +2,11 @@
<plugin name="opengl">
<_short>OpenGL</_short>
<_long>OpenGL Plugin</_long>
+ <deps>
+ <requirement>
+ <plugin>composite</plugin>
+ </requirement>
+ </deps>
<options>
<option name="texture_filter" type="int">
<_short>Texture Filter</_short>
diff --git a/metadata/place.xml.in b/metadata/place.xml.in
index 9f54ea4..bad213d 100644
--- a/metadata/place.xml.in
+++ b/metadata/place.xml.in
@@ -2,7 +2,7 @@
<plugin name="place">
<_short>Place Windows</_short>
<_long>Place windows at appropriate positions when mapped</_long>
- <screen>
+ <options>
<option name="workarounds" type="bool">
<_short>Workarounds</_short>
<_long>Window placement workarounds</_long>
@@ -97,6 +97,6 @@
<min>1</min>
<max>32</max>
</option>
- </screen>
+ </options>
</plugin>
</compiz>
diff --git a/metadata/resize.xml.in b/metadata/resize.xml.in
index b5314f4..e2569b4 100644
--- a/metadata/resize.xml.in
+++ b/metadata/resize.xml.in
@@ -2,6 +2,12 @@
<plugin name="resize">
<_short>Resize Window</_short>
<_long>Resize window</_long>
+ <deps>
+ <relation type="after">
+ <plugin>composite</plugin>
+ <plugin>opengl</plugin>
+ </relation>
+ </deps>
<options>
<option name="initiate_normal_key" type="key">
<_short>Initiate Normal Window Resize</_short>
diff --git a/metadata/switcher.xml.in b/metadata/switcher.xml.in
index 992d4c9..dda448a 100644
--- a/metadata/switcher.xml.in
+++ b/metadata/switcher.xml.in
@@ -2,6 +2,11 @@
<plugin name="switcher">
<_short>Application Switcher</_short>
<_long>Application Switcher</_long>
+ <deps>
+ <requirement>
+ <plugin>opengl</plugin>
+ </requirement>
+ </deps>
<options>
<option name="next_button" type="button">
<_short>Next window</_short>
diff --git a/metadata/water.xml.in b/metadata/water.xml.in
index 557eaee..af41bc9 100644
--- a/metadata/water.xml.in
+++ b/metadata/water.xml.in
@@ -7,6 +7,9 @@
<plugin>blur</plugin>
<plugin>video</plugin>
</relation>
+ <requirement>
+ <plugin>opengl</plugin>
+ </requirement>
</deps>
<options>
<option name="initiate_key" type="key">